2
Equivalent sound pressure level, according to ISO 22868:2011, is calculated as the time-weighted energy
total for different sound pressure levels under various working conditions. Typical statistical dispersion for
equivalent sound pressure level is a standard deviation of 1 dB (A).
3
Vibration level, according to EN 62841-4-1. Reported data for vibration level has a typical statistical disper-
sion (standard deviation) of 1 m/s
2
. Declared vibration data from measurements when the machine is fitted
with a bar length and recommended chain type. If the machine is fitted with a different bar length, the vibra-
tion level may vary by max ± 1.5 m/s
2
.
4
Equivalent vibration level is measured and calculated as for combustion engine powered chainsaws. These
figures are quoted to be able to compare vibration data regardless of type of engine according to ISO
22867:2011.
